Black Starlets thrash Serbia 5-1 in UEFA U-16 development tournament

Ghana’s U-17 national men’s football team, the Black Starlets, bounced back emphatically from their opening defeat in the UEFA U-16 development tournament with a dominant 5-1 victory over Serbia on Friday (26 April).

The Laryea Kingston-coached side, playing at the VGAFK Stadium in Volgograd, Russia, controlled possession throughout the match, enjoying a significant 77% share of the ball. Their attacking prowess shone through early on, with Abdulai Nortey curling a superb opener past Serbian goalkeeper Bogdan Bogdanovic in the 16th minute.

Ghana continued to dictate the tempo, doubling their lead just before halftime through a penalty calmly converted by Benjamin Hanson. The Black Starlets’ dominance extended further with a precise header from Koranteng David, sending them into the break with a commanding 3-0 advantage.

The second half mirrored the first, with Ghana dictating play. Ebenezer Anane added a fourth goal with a skillful strike in the 63rd minute. While Serbia’s captain, Pavle Stulic, pulled a goal back five minutes later, the Black Starlets remained firmly in control.

Skipper Benjamin Tsivanyo capped off a dominant display with a brilliant solo effort, putting the final touches on a comprehensive victory.

This win not only serves as a redemption for the team’s opening 3-1 loss to Russia but also provides valuable insights and momentum for Head Coach Laryea Kingston as they prepare for their final group stage match against Kazakhstan.
